Nordic defence ministers will meet in Rovaniemi, Lapland on Tuesday and Wednesday to discuss various issues including defence cooperation, said the Ministry of Defence in a press release on Monday.
Finnish Defence Minister Antti Häkkänen will host a meeting as Chair the Nordic Defence Cooperation (NORDEFCO) in 2025.
"The agenda of the Nordic Defence Ministers' meeting is exceptionally heavy. We are taking forward the strengthening of Nordic defence and security of supply on many tracks. The agenda also includes current NATO and EU issues as well as support for Ukraine and the US relationship,” said Häkkänen in the press release.
In connection with the meeting, the Ministers will also get to know the conditions of northern defence and Finnish conscript training in Lapland, said Häkkänen.
The fourth meeting of Nordic defence ministers in 2025 will also focus on Nordic air force cooperation, industrial capacity and ammunition cooperation, the press release added.
